Show that the equation Y -2= 4(3x+5) is a liner and then tell if it represents a proportional or nonproportional relationship be
lozanna [386]

Answer:

y=12x+22 is linear but not proportional

Step-by-step explanation:

y-2=4(3x+5)

This is a linear equation because it has an x and y within the expression without exponents or other complex operators. We can rearrange and simplify the equation into slope-intercept form.

y-2=4(3x+5)\\y-2=12x+20\\y-2+2=12x+20+2\\y=12x+22

This linear equation follows the form y=mx+b where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ept. For this function, m=12 and b=22. This is not a proportional relationship because the function's y-intercept is something other than 0.

What is 36kg in the ratio 7:2
babymother [125]

Answer:

28 Kg : 8 Kg

Step-by-step explanation:

Sum the parts of the ratio, 7 + 2 = 9 parts

Divide 36 Kg by 9 to find the value of one part of the ratio.

36 Kg ÷ 9 = 4 Kg ← value of 1 part of the ratio, thus

7 parts = 7 × 4 Kg = 28 Kg

2 parts = 2 × 4Kg = 8 Kg

36 Kg in the ratio 7 : 2 = 28 Kg : 8 Kg
